Chef Manager Care Home | Mayflower Court, Southampton

Full-time | 40 hours over 4 days | Every other weekend off

Looking for a Chef Manager job in Southampton with great worklife balance? Mayflower Court is hiring an experienced Chef Manager / Kitchen Manager to lead our friendly catering team and deliver high-quality meals for our 72 residents.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ead and develop the kitchen team

  • Plan, prepare, and cook seasonal menus

  • Cater for dietary requirements, allergens, and nutritional needs

  • Manage food safety, hygiene standards, stock, and ordering

  • Maintain a smooth and efficient care home kitchen operation

Anchor is Englands largest not-for-profit providers of care and housing for older people. Our heartfelt ambition is to transform housing and care so everyone can have a home where they love living in later life.

Were not-for-profit which means every penny we make or save is invested in the people who live with us, the places they live and the people who work here. That means a better standard of care and customer service, better wages, more investment in training and development and improved facilities.

Anchor is proud to be an equal opportunity employer. We aim to celebrate diversity and inclusion in all that we do, as we know that the more diverse our colleagues are, the better care and support we can give to our residents and each other.

We are proud to have an LGBT+ group for our residents, and also Disability, LGBT+ and race and ethnicity colleague networks. These work to celebrate diversity, address concerns, review policy and practice and empower their members. We also have an Inclusive Ambassador network to allow all colleagues to be part of promoting diversity and to be an ally to others.

We are a member of Inclusive Employers, a Stonewall Diversity Champion and a signatory to the Care Leaver Covenant and HouseProud Pledge schemes.
